Output 09297dacd1e6cfb5bf6056b29cce43db90d26bb03d99eea4a6a38d152d6e3886:50

value
2407662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c665bb65c4795a1bed773738469060a65b6528 OP_EQUAL
address
3AhHpEcVs3zJTav8kjaFHUgALuP3JEWS3U
transaction
09297dacd1e6cfb5bf6056b29cce43db90d26bb03d99eea4a6a38d152d6e3886
spent
true